How to withdraw funds from your markets.com account

    Here, we’re going to go through step-by-step how you can withdraw funds from your markets.com trading account, via our mobile app.

    Let’s get started:

    Step 1: On the main app screen, click the ‘Account’ icon in the bottom right of the screen.

    Step 2: On the next page, press the ‘Withdrawal’ option.

    Step 3: On the following page, press the ‘Withdraw’ button at the top of the page.

    Step 4: You’ll be taken through to the screen where you can choose which of your trading accounts you want to withdraw from. (Use the drop-down menu to select the correct one.)

    Step 5: Tap the blue ‘Add method’ button.

    Step 6: On the next screen, select your chosen method from the three options of Neteller, Skrill and Wire Transfer.

    Step 7: Once you’ve picked your method, you’ll be taken through to a page where you can input the details of where you want the funds sent. (You may be asked to provide verification documents for your chosen account, depending on your situation.)

    Step 8: Once you’ve inputted your details and finalised them, you can return to the main withdrawal page and tap the blue ‘Withdraw’ button at the bottom of the screen to finalise your withdrawal.

    And that’s it.
